CA <br />J U L 19 1994 RESOLUTION NO. 94- 93 <br />by Indian River County with FDOT, TCRPC, the City of Vero <br />Beach, and the developer prior to 1997. <br />As a minimum, the report shall: <br />a. present existing traffic volumes; <br />b. present existing level of service with all analysis used <br />to determine the level of service; <br />C. determine traffic projections for each roadway link and <br />intersection for one year into the future including <br />background, discounting all new traffic from other <br />projects in Indian River County, plus project traffic; <br />d. specify roadway expansions necessary to provide Level of <br />Service D for peak-hour/peak-season conditions on the <br />monitored roadway links and intersections; and <br />e. identify methods for funding the necessary roadway <br />expansions. <br />Commencing in the year 1997, no further building permits for <br />the Indian River Mall Development of Regional Impact shall be <br />issued after three months from the due date of -the Annual <br />Report as established in the Development Order, until the <br />Traffic Monitoring Report referenced above has been submitted <br />to and approved by Indian River County, FDOT, TCRPC, in <br />consultation with the City of Vero Beach. <br />No further certificates of occupancy shall be issued for the <br />Indian River Mall Development of Regional Impact within a year <br />of the date of the Traffic Monitoring Report until roadway <br />expansions, if any, specified in the approved Traffic <br />Monitoring Report are under construction. Monitoring of the <br />roadway links may be discontinued once expansion of the <br />roadway links to a four -lane cross-section are under <br />construction or by buildout of the Indian River Mall. <br />44. No building permits for the Indian River Mall Development of <br />Regional Impact shall be issued until either: 1) contracts <br />have been let for the following intersection expansions; 2) <br />the following expansions have been included within the first <br />three years of Indian River County's adopted Capital <br />Improvement Program: or 3) a local government development <br />agreement consistent with sections 163.3220 through 163.3243, <br />F.S. has been executed and attached as an exhibit to the <br />Development Order via an amendment to the Development Order, <br />for the following improvements. Any such agreement shall <br />include provisions for surety to guarantee construction of <br />required improvements. <br />a.
